Evaluation of postpartum programs in Brazil: bibliometric profile of scientific production (2000-2019)

ABSTRACT

Postpartum care is a component of women’s health care, included in programs developed in Brazil, with the objective of improving maternal and child health indicators. The study aimed to analyze the state of the art of evaluative studies on programs related to puerperal care in Brazil from 2000 to 2019. The research was limited to the identification and analysis of articles published in peer-reviewed journals. The review was carried out based on research of the descriptors evaluation, programs and postpartum in the BVS, SciELO and Scopus portals, complemented by the verification of the references cited in the articles to include relevant studies. In total, 42 articles were identified, which were analyzed according to previously established criteria. The results of the bibliometric profile of intellectual production identified: absence of authors/research centers specialized in the evaluation interface and postpartum care programs, regional disparities in the production of knowledge, more articles on the Prenatal and Birth Humanization Program and the Baby Friendly Hospital Initiative, with scarce use of theoretical and methodological references in the field of Evaluation. The discussion carried out seeks to contextualize the scientific production analyzed in relation to the constitution of the space of health Evaluation in Brazil.
